How To Choose The Best Brow Tint

Not all brow tints behave the same way. Some deliver a skin-staining effect that lasts for days, while others are essentially tinted gels that wash off with your evening cleanser. The right choice depends on your brow density, daily routine, and how much time you want to spend on application.

Peel-Off vs. Tinted Gel: Wear Time Expectations

Peel-off tints like the Maybelline Brow Tattoo deposit pigment onto the skin beneath the brow hairs, leaving a stain that persists through multiple washes. These are ideal for sparse or over-plucked brows because they fill in the gaps directly on the skin. Tinted gels, on the other hand, coat the existing hairs with color and a flexible film former. They offer instant definition but require daily reapplication because they wash off with standard cleansing.

Bristle Design and Applicator Precision

The brush is the unsung variable in brow tint performance. A micro-precision brush with short, densely packed bristles deposits product exactly where you need it without overshooting your arch. Longer, fluffier bristles create a more diffused, feathery look but can deposit too much pigment in the center of the brow. Look for a wand that matches your desired level of control — shorter bristles for precision, longer bristles for volume.

Pigment Undertone and Oxidation

A brow tint labeled “Dark Brown” might pull warm (reddish) or cool (ashy) depending on the formula’s iron oxide blend. Warm undertones can look unnatural on neutral or cool skin, while overly ashy shades can read gray on darker hair. Read reviews about the actual color deposit — many users note that a formula appears redder once it dries. If you have neutral-toned hair, a balanced brown without obvious warm or cool bias is safest.

1. Anastasia Beverly Hills Tinted Brow Gel

7 ShadesFlexible Hold

Anastasia Beverly Hills has built its reputation on brow precision, and this tinted gel shows why. The formula uses light-refracting particles to create natural dimension rather than a flat wash of color, so brows look fuller without appearing painted on. The hold is flexible — enough to tame unruly hairs but not so stiff that brows feel brittle to the touch.

The shade range runs seven deep, from light blonde to the espresso variant reviewed here, which suits black hair with a warm undertone. The wand features medium-length bristles that coat each hair evenly without clumping; a single pass delivers sheer tint, while a second layer builds toward fuller coverage. Users who have reached for this product for years consistently note that the tube lasts several months of daily use, making the price-per-wear competitive against cheaper alternatives that dry out faster.

Where this gel falls short is in lamination-level hold. If you require a wet-look sculpted arch that stays put through humidity, the flexible grip here may feel too gentle. It is designed for a natural, brushed-up finish — not a glossy, laminated effect. For everyday definition that never looks heavy, this formula is the benchmark.

2. Milk Makeup KUSH Fiber Brow Gel

Thickening FibersVegan Waxes

Milk Makeup’s KUSH Fiber Brow Gel solves a specific problem: sparse brows that need actual volume — not just color — but look stiff and fake after a fiber formula sets. This gel uses vegan waxes to create a flexible hold and infuses the formula with hemp seed oil, which conditions brow hairs while fusing the thickening fibers to the skin and hair. The result is a noticeably fluffier, fuller look without the crunchy feel.

The applicator is the star here. The bristles are short and precise, allowing you to use the tip for targeted deposits in the sparsest areas of the arch. The tint itself is buildable: one coat defines, two coats fill, and three coats create near-powder density. Users with lighter hair — especially platinum or cool blonde — have praised the shade accuracy, noting that the color reads natural rather than brassy. The formula also removes cleanly with a standard oil-based cleanser, leaving no staining.

The trade-off is that this is a daily gel, not a semi-permanent tint. If you have absolutely no brow hair in certain sections, the fibers can only do so much — they need some existing hair to cling to. The price sits at the premium end of the spectrum, but the conditioning ingredients and fiber technology justify the cost for those who prioritize both volume and brow health.

3. Maybelline New York Brow Tattoo Longlasting Tint

Peel-Off72-Hour Wear

Maybelline’s Brow Tattoo is the rare drugstore product that genuinely competes with salon semi-permanent brow tints. The peel-off formula deposits pigment directly onto the skin beneath the brows, creating a stain that persists through showers, sweat, and face washing for up to three days. For someone with sparse or over-plucked brows who wants the look of filled-in arches without daily effort, this is the most time-efficient option on the list.

The application method is specific: apply the gel to clean, dry brows, let it set for 20 minutes to two hours (depending on how intense you want the stain), then peel the dried film off from the inner corner outward. The longer you leave it on, the darker and longer-lasting the tint. Users with chemo-related brow loss have reported excellent results because the product stains the skin itself, creating a frame even where no hair exists. The dark brown shade reviewed here deposits a rich, warm pigment that reads natural on medium to deep skin tones.

The consistency of results depends heavily on technique. Applying too thick a layer can cause the peel to break apart, leaving patchy staining. The formula also has a learning curve — first-time users often peel too early, resulting in a faint reddish tint rather than the full brown. And because the product stains skin, any application outside your natural arch will leave a colored mark for a day or two. For those willing to practice, the payoff is excellent brow definition that requires no touch-ups.

4. SACE LADY 2-Color Eyebrow Gel Set

Dual ShadeAirless Pump

SACE LADY takes the dual-shade approach — two cream gel tints in one set, each paired with a mini brow brush. This design suits those who want to mix shades to match their exact brow color or who prefer a lighter shade for the inner brow and a deeper one for the tail. The formula is a pigmented wax cream that dries down completely clear, leaving no residue or flaking, and the brand claims 24-hour wear that is both waterproof and humidity-proof.

The airless pump packaging is a genuine advantage over standard dip-tube designs. It dispenses a controlled amount of product per pump, reducing waste and preventing the formula from drying out. Users note that a single small pump covers both brows, and the included brushes — while functional — are the weakest link in the set. The brush quality resembles a low-cost craft paint applicator, which makes precision work harder than it needs to be. Substituting your own angled brow brush improves the application experience considerably.

The color payoff is intense — some users describe the pigment as very dark, so applying sparingly is essential. Those who prefer a lighter, more natural tint may find the saturation overwhelming. However, for active days where you need your brow look to survive sweat, rain, or a workout, this formula provides the most reliable waterproof lock in the lineup. The dual-shade set also makes it a strong option for someone who wants flexibility in brow color without buying multiple products.

5. Well People Expressionist Brow Gel

Wax-BasedVegan

Well People takes a clean-beauty-first approach with a wax-based formula built around cocoa butter and sunflower seed wax — ingredients that condition brow hairs while holding them in place. The micro-precision brush is short and dense, allowing you to groom individual hairs without depositing excess product on the skin. The finish is natural, with a soft hold that never feels stiff or sticky.

This gel is dermatologist-developed, Leaping Bunny certified, and vegan, making it a strong choice for anyone who prioritizes ingredient safety or is pregnant and avoiding certain chemicals. The formula does not contain the film formers or plasticizers found in conventional waterproof brow gels, which means it washes off easily with a standard cleanser — no double-cleansing required. Users who have switched to this from conventional brow gels report that the tube lasts three to four months with daily use, which is solid longevity for a clean formula.

The main caveat is that this formula is prone to peeling if over-applied. Applying too heavy a layer can result in visible white or clear flakes once the wax dries. The fix is to wipe the brush on the tube rim before application to remove excess product. The shade range is also narrower than competitors — currently limited to a few brown tones, which may not suit those with very light or very dark hair. For the user who wants a non-toxic, plant-powered daily brow tint and is willing to refine their application technique, this gel delivers dependable, natural results.

FAQ

How long should I leave a peel-off brow tint on for best results?
For a light, natural-looking stain, 20 minutes is sufficient. For a more defined, darker tint that lasts closer to three days, leave the gel on for at least one to two hours. The pigment continues to absorb into the skin as the gel dries, so longer wear time directly correlates with longer-lasting results.
Can brow tint cause breakouts on the forehead or around the brows?
Breakouts are possible if the formula contains comedogenic ingredients like heavy waxes or certain oils. Cocoa butter, for example, has a moderate comedogenic rating. If you are prone to forehead acne, choose a water-based or film-forming gel formula rather than a wax-based cream, and ensure you remove the tint completely at the end of the day with a non-comedogenic cleanser.
Why does my brow tint look red after it dries?
A red or coppery dry-down indicates that the formula’s iron oxide blend is weighted toward red oxide (CI 77491). This is common in “Dark Brown” or “Chocolate” shades that aim to create warmth. If you have neutral or cool-toned brows, look for a shade labeled “Ash Brown” or “Cool Brown,” which uses a higher proportion of black and yellow oxides to neutralize the warmth. Testing a small swatch on your inner arm can reveal the true dry-down color before you apply it to your brows.
How do I prevent a brow tint from flaking or peeling during the day?
Flaking usually results from applying too thick a layer. Wipe the applicator wand on the rim of the tube to remove excess product before grooming your brows. If you are using a wax-based gel, avoid layering second coats before the first coat has fully set — this can cause the wax to roll up into visible flakes. For film-forming gels, ensure your brows are completely clean and free of oil before application, as residual oil will prevent the film from adhering evenly.
